Understanding Gabapentin for Dogs

Gabapentin is an anticonvulsant and nerve pain medication that is often used in veterinary medicine to treat chronic pain, especially neuropathic pain. It’s also prescribed for seizure management and anxiety in dogs. Although generally considered safe, the effectiveness and safety of Gabapentin largely depend on administering the correct dose. Uses of Gabapentin in Dogs

Gabapentin is primarily used for humans, but its use in veterinary medicine is considered “off-label,” meaning it hasn’t been FDA-approved for pets. However, it can be prescribed by veterinarians to manage pain, seizures, and anxiety in dogs.

  • Seizure Control: Gabapentin has anticonvulsant properties, making it effective as an additional treatment for dogs with hard-to-control seizures or those whose current medications aren’t providing enough relief.
  • Pain Relief: Gabapentin also works as a pain reliever, especially for chronic and neuropathic pain. It is commonly prescribed for dogs with joint issues like arthritis. When used in combination with other pain medications such as NSAIDs or opioids, gabapentin can enhance pain management, especially after surgery.
  • Managing Anxiety: Gabapentin can be helpful for dogs dealing with anxiety, including stress from thunderstorms or visits to the vet. It likely works by reducing the release of certain brain chemicals that cause anxiety, giving dogs a calmer, more relaxed feeling.

Gabapentin Dosage Guidelines

The dosage of Gabapentin for dogs varies based on the condition being treated:

  • Pain Management: Gabapentin is typically prescribed at a dose of 5-10 mg per kg of body weight, administered every 8 to 12 hours.
  • Seizure Control: For seizure management, higher doses may be necessary, often in the range of 10-20 mg per kg every 8 hours.
  • Anxiety Relief: When used for anxiety, doses can vary, but they generally fall within the same range as those for pain management.

However, these are general guidelines and individual requirements may vary. A Gabapentin dog dosage calculator can help determine the precise dose based on your dog’s weight and the condition being treated.

Gabapentin for Dogs Dosage by Weight

When calculating the dosage, the weight of your dog is a crucial factor. Below is a gabapentin for dogs dosage chart that offers a general guideline for Gabapentin administration based on the dog’s weight:

Dog’s WeightLow DoseHigh Dose
5-10 lbs.50 mg compounded liquid100 mg compounded liquid or capsule
11-20 lbs.100 mg, oral capsules200 mg, oral capsules
21-30 lbs.150 mg, oral tablets300 mg, oral capsules or tablets
31-40 lbs.200 mg, oral capsules400 mg, oral tablets or capsules
41-50 lbs.250 mg, oral tablets500 mg, oral capsules or tablets
51-60 lbs.300 mg, oral capsules or tablets600 mg, oral capsules or tablets
61-70 lbs.350 mg, oral tablets700 mg, oral capsules or tablets
Note: This chart serves as a starting point but it’s important to remember that your veterinarian will adjust the dosage based on your dog’s specific needs. Safety Considerations and Side Effects

Gabapentin can cause some side effects in dogs, particularly at higher doses. The most common ones include:

  • Sedation: Drowsiness or excessive tiredness.
  • Lethargy: A general lack of energy.
  • Poor balance and difficulty walking (ataxia): This can make your dog seem uncoordinated.

These effects are usually more noticeable when gabapentin is given in higher doses. If your dog is using gabapentin for reasons other than sedation, such as pain or seizure control, these side effects may interfere with their normal activities. It’s important to consult your vet before making any adjustments to the dosage or form of gabapentin to minimize these issues.

In rarer cases, some dogs may experience vomiting or diarrhea, especially at higher doses.

Most of these side effects tend to wear off within 8 to 12 hours.
